Ready to Learn workshop participation: Short-term impacts: Final report
Johnson, Amy W.; Vogel, Cheri; Boller, Kimberley; Uhl, Stacey; , December 23, 2003

An experimental, random assignment component of the comprehensive evaluation of Ready to Learn--a program in which Public Broadcasting Service member stations broadcast a mandated number of hours of children's programming and coordinators at each station engage in outreach activities (including parent and early childhood educator workshops) to facilitate the use of this programming as an educational tool--that focused on the short-term impacts of outreach activities on parents' and early childhood educators' behaviors, based on comparing assessments of workshop participants and nonparticipants
